Please enable it to continue. solarwinds free scp serverDichanthelium is genus of flowering plants of the grass family, Poaceae. They are known commonly as rosette grasses and panicgrasses. Formerly a subgenus of the genus Panicum, Dichanthelium was elevated to genus status in 1974. Its species are still treated as members of Panicum by some authorities, because … See more These are perennial grasses, sometimes with rhizomes. The grasses may overwinter as rosettes of short, wide leaves and then produce longer, wider leaves on the stem during spring. They produce hollow stems a few centimeters … See more There are about 72 species in the genus. Species include: • Dichanthelium aciculare (Desv. ex Poir.)
